TROPANG GIGA RULES PBA 3 x 3

4 min read

A shower of white confetti greeted the TNT Tropang Giga after Gryann Mendoza buried the game – winning basket to survive past Purefoods, 21 – 19, via overtime in their PBA 3 x 3 Third Conference grand finals clash at the packed Robinsons Place Manila Sunday, July 3.

Lefty Mendoza canned eight markers, including the crucial two – pointer in extra time for TNT’s dramatic come – from – behind victory.

TNT coach Mau Belen praised his players’ fighting spirit.

“Grabe ang pinakitang puso ng players ko ( My players showed great hearts ). Last 1:30 we were down by four, Purefoods ( was ) two points away from winning the championship. We just didn’t give up. This is the type of team we have,” Belen was quoted as saying.

Almond Vosotros chipped in five points while Samboy de Leon and Lervin Flores made identical four points for TNT, which romped away with the grand prize of P750,000.

The Purefoods Titans, bannered by Eriobu Eriobu, Marvin Hayes, Jed Mendoza, and Jun Bonsubre, settled for the runner – up prize of P250,000.

Vosotros captured the Scoring King of the Conference plum to receive the P30,000 bonus.

TNT also ruled the first, third, and fourth legs while it finished second in the fifth and sixth legs.

Purefoods took a 19 – 15 advantage with Joseph Eriobu’s drive but Belen’s wards put up a searing rally at the stretch.

With Mendoza’s twin baskets, Tropang Giga cut the Titan’s lead to just two. His teammate De Leon then buried two charities after he was fouled while grabbing a rebound after Eriobu missed his shot. The match was tied at 19 – all.

Vosotros and De Leon took turns to easily seal the match for Tropang Giga but failed

as time expired.

But all hope was not lost as Mendoza delivered a shot from beyond the arc in extra time.

Earlier, top seed TNT crushed San Miguel Beer, 21 – 15, in the semifinals after demolishing Barangay Ginebra, 21 – 10, in the quarterfinals.

No. 3 Purefoods, meanwhile, outlasted the Sista Super Sealers, 21 – 19, in the other semifinals match after escaping past Limitless, 18 – 16, in the last 16.

The Sista Super Sealers finished third after eking out a 21 – 20 comeback victory over San Miguel.

Down by three points, the Super Sealers came back strong behind Jam Jamon’s back – to – back deuces and Kenneth Mocon’s driving layup.

Sista, who was also composed of Joseph Manlangit and Jamil Gabawan, received P100,000 cash prize.
